Transaction 9329785bf02e7ffc789931bdd400650223c651b08d2a119d779790f3cf2df460
1 Input
1 Output
-
9329785bf02e7ffc789931bdd400650223c651b08d2a119d779790f3cf2df460:0
- value
- 26086245
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 638897e95f325fa60bb077a951c2eef36c21e2d7 OP_EQUAL
- address
- 3AmJTDCRPqidKSBobfP3Wy1XvUx6ocgRba